The Clinical Transition Specialist is an experienced sales professional who uses sales techniques to sell Option Care products and services to discharging patients. They are responsible for educating patients, their families and the facility staff about how the services and products will be facilitated at an alternative site. Clinical Transition Specialists ensure proper placement of patients within the Home Health Care setting by assessing patients, gathering preadmission information, collaborating with internal (intake) and external (case managers, discharge planners) partners to ensure quality of service and implementation of an effective treatment plan. Clinical Transition Specialists are also responsible for proactively building strong relationships with referral sources and partnering with Account Managers to grow referral rates and achieve sales goals.
